Cell Messaging Layer: v2.4 released

The Cell Messaging Layer is an extremely fast, MPI-like communication library for clusters of Cell Broadband Engine processors. With it, any Cell synergistic processing element (SPE) can communicate directly with any other SPE, even across a network.

Version 2.4 of the Cell Messaging Layer (CML) is now available from
SourceForge. CML is a message-passing library that simplifies
programming clusters of Cell processors (as used, for example, in the
PlayStation 3 and in LANL's Roadrunner supercomputer). CML 2.4 fixes
a sporadic hang-on-exit bug, simplifies SPE-to-PPE RPC calls by
allowing CML_BYTE_SWAP_NOT_NEEDED as the unit of byte-swapping,
cooperates better with applications by using mfc_tag_reserve() to
allocate DMA tags, and refactors the collective-communication code to
use less memory in some cases.... read more

Cell Messaging Layer runs on world's fastest supercomputer

The latest release of the Cell Messaging Layer (2.0) has run
successfully on Roadrunner, the world's fastest supercomputer and the
first supercomputer to reach a sustained petaflop/s of performance on
the LINPACK benchmark. A CML-based implementation of the Sweep3D
neutron-transport code ran without a hitch on 69,120 SPE cores (12
compute units * 180 nodes/CU * 2 Cell blades/node * 2 Cells/blade * 8
SPEs/Cell), demonstrating that the Cell Messaging Layer scales to
clusters of thousands of Cells or tens of thousands of SPE cores.... read more
